Select the incorrect statement from the following.
Options
A.It is possible to change the rate constant for a reaction by changing the temperature.
B.The rate constant for a reaction is independent of reactant concentrations.
C.The rate of a catalysed reaction is always independent from the concentration of the catalyst.
D.In multistep reactions, the rate determining step is the slowest one.
Solution
The ratio of catalytic reaction may depend on catalyst concentration.
